Reporting to the Manager, Career Learning and Development, the Student Office Assistant contributes to student retention and success and to the University’s reputation for quality by providing administrative and project support to the Career Learning and Development team. The responsibilities will primarily include web editing and updating, employer engagement material/collateral development, assisting with outreach and event initiatives as needed.Job RequirementsA registered student at RRU Strong writing skills and attention to detail and accuracy Experience working with Adobe Pro and website editing tools Excellent interpersonal skills Excellent written and oral communication skills Experience working in a multicultural environmentAdditional InformationThis is a casual, on-call position. The hourly rate is $24.17. Due to its limited term nature, this position is not eligible for enrolment in the University’s Benefits Plan, but you will be provided with 4% in lieu of vacation.
